If you’re planning on fitting engineered wood flooring in a room where you have under floor heating, it’s essential not to reduce the heating’s effectiveness by choosing the wrong underlay. When it comes to choosing your fitting method when you have under floor heating, the likelihood is that you’ll be forced to plump for either glue-down or floating. That said, if you have electric under floor heating, you should avoid glue-down as an installation method. However, as already stated, there is no need for underlay if you choose the glue-down method, but if you choose a floating method, you need to make sure that you choose an underlay that allows maximum heat transfer, at the same time as offering all the other benefits of a quality underlay.Read MoreRead Less Engineered wood flooring is a flooring option which has grown substantially in popularity in recent years and it’s easy to see why.

Although only a few years ago, it was reasonably easy to spot the difference between engineered wood flooring and solid wood flooring, this is no longer the case. In fact, in most cases, when you opt for a quality engineered wood floor, the vast majority of people would seriously struggle to say whether or not it’s solid wood. With all the other advantages associated with this type of flooring, this authentic look truly is the icing on the cake.
